It is a very nice family hotel. Friendly staff that is willing to making your stay very comfortable. We stayed on the 3rd floor where our room had a kitchen that contained a refrigerator and a hotplate. Not many hotels come that equip. House keeping is also great. Thumbs up to Park House.
